Hello.

Is this sentence grammatically correct?

He decided to become a singer after having spent time with his friend who was holding concerts around the country.

Yes, it's correct. I don't see any problem with it. In fact, after having spent adds an extra sense of 'after-ness' that after spending does not have. Whether a sentence needs that extra after-ness is a different question.
